You are correct that the Humvee was originally designed to be a relatively lightweight jeep replacement. Hence the military designation: High Mobility Multipurpose Wheeled Vehicle (HMMWV).

CJ Jeeps and most HMMWVs also had zero protection. The problem is once you start asking the vehicle to be armored, you end up with the 14,000lb Oshkosh L-ATV which doesn’t fit in a Chinook and can’t be transported at all by the Blackhawk, and it only carries 4.
